150 Programming Questions and Solutions
Ratings12
Average rating3.8
This was a thoroughly useful book for getting my 2nd software engineering job in 2016. At this point, I'd say there are various online resources that are way more practical for this purpose, like Neetcode for example.
Really enjoy this book. each time I get bored or want to keep tweaking and improving my problem solving skills, this book is what I turn to. There are questions within the book as well that can couple well with leetcode or hackerrank. Definitely recommend for software engineers whether you are full stack, back-end or front end developers.
I think I preferred Skiena's Algorithm Design Manual as a refresher on algorithms/interview prep, but this book is also very good (and easier to find!). Let's see if it gets me the job!